    Notorious far-right pundit Rick Wiles is getting a taste of his own bitter medicine after catching COVID-19, a disease he claimed was �God�s
    judgement� for LGBT+ people.

    The controversial figure, who claims God sent COVID-19 �to purge a lot of
    sin off this planet,� was hospitalised with the virus this week. He is 67
    years old.

    The news was confirmed on Saturday (29 May) by Raymond Burkhart, vice
    president of Wiles� church, who said the pastor is now �very weak�.

    �Rick is very much in need of your continued prayers,� he said in an email
    to devotees. �Today, he was taken to the emergency room, and under medical advice, was admitted to the hospital. He is currently on oxygen and is
    expected to remain there for a number of days.�

    Wiles� far-right conspiracy show TruNews followed this up with an �urgent�
    plea for an �army of people� to pray for the ailing preacher.

    Exactly how he caught the virus will be a mystery to his followers after
    he blamed it on sinners, specifically the �vile, disgusting people� who
    are �transgendering little children�.

    �Look at the spiritual rebellion that is in this country, the hatred of
    God, the hatred of the Bible, the hatred of righteousness, the hatred of innocence,� he told TruNews viewers.

    �Vile, disgusting people in this country now, transgendering little
    children, perverting them. Look at the rapes, and the sexual immorality,
    and the filth on our TVs and our movies.

    �Folks, the Death Angel may be moving right now across the planet,� he
    added. �This is the time to get right with God.�

    Pinning global disasters on people he dislikes is entirely in keeping with
    his version of Christianity, which includes blaming �gay Nazis� for the
    Las Vegas mass shooting and �the sexual perversion movement� for Hurricane Harvey.

    More recently, he�s proudly stated that the world would be a �better
    place� after a �genocide� caused by vaccines wipes out 70 per cent of the population.

    �I am not going to be vaccinated,� the broadcaster told his audience last month. �I�m going to be one of the survivors. I�m going to survive the genocide.

    �The only good thing that will come out of this is a lot of stupid people
    will be killed off. If the vaccine wipes out a lot of stupid people, well, we�ll have a better world.�

    Perhaps anticipating the comments heading Rick Wiles� way, TruNews has
    said that eternal damnation will await anyone mocking Wiles�s affliction,
    or suggesting that it�s �karma�.

    �Already, the naysayers and mockers have started with their taunts,� the channel�s website said. �Let them speak their foolish words and let them
    mock. It will only serve to be used to fuel their flames of torment in
    hell unless they repent.�
